Morphology
partial + differential + equation
Each part contributes directly: 'differential equation' denotes an equation involving derivatives and the modifier 'partial' specifies that these are partial derivatives with respect to one variable of a multivariable function. The phrase is compositional and follows regular noun-modifier patterns (and has clear equivalents in other languages), so a learner who knows the constituent mathematical terms can derive the full meaning.
Etymology
The term partial differential equation comes from three simple ideas: partial means 'only part or one direction', differential means 'a very small change', and equation means 'a rule that connects things'. So it is a rule that connects small changes in different directions, which is why people use it to describe heat, waves and other changes over space and time.
